The basic way to explain affiliate marketing is to see it is a way of making money online and increasing traffic to your business by publishing a link on your website promoting a product, service or site of another business. This can profit your business by bringing your commissions or reciprocal services.
Track and analyze the exact source of every visitor to your affiliate links. By doing this you can identify which marketing techniques are bringing in visitors and, more importantly, where visitors with the highest conversion rates originate. You can then concentrate your time and money on only the successful marketing techniques.

Use the internet to check the history of an affiliate program prior to signing on with them. It is so important to know who you are working with so you do not find yourself frustrated and angry about not getting the money that they owe you for selling their products.
Avoid affiliate marketing scams by doing some research before choosing an affiliate. Companies that charge you to be an affiliate are not reputable, nor are companies that require you to buy its product before becoming an affiliate. Doing a quick Google search of potential affiliates can save you from scams.
There are several types of affiliate marketing strategies you can use. You can either link as an affiliate directly with a company or you can join a service that will help you get links for affiliates. Affiliating directly with the company pays the most money. Using a secondhand source will cost you a bit out of the pay.
Be honest about the fact that you hope your visitors will help you out by clicking on your affiliate links. If it seems as if you are trying to hide the fact that you are an affiliate, your visitors will just go straight to the vendor’s website and purchase the product directly. Then you won’t get credit; even though, you have put in a lot of work to promote the product!

When you are first exploring the world of affiliate marketing, limit yourself to offering no more than a half-a-dozen affiliate products. This narrow portfolio will let you learn the ropes and get to know the back end of the affiliate process. Thorough mastery of these basics will make it easier to tackle the new challenges that bigger product portfolios bring.

Make sure that your affiliate credits you for multiple referrals. When a customer returns to buy something from the affiliate, this is a multiple referral. You should receive commission for the repeat visits just as you received it for initially sending the customer to them. Confirm before signing that your affiliate program tracks and pays on these multiple referrals.
Make the subscription options to your list very accessible. A visitor should be able to decide to join your list from any page on your website. The process should be simple and easy to complete. Usually people will decide to join your list after viewing a couple of the pages on your site. You want to have a subscription link available as soon as they make the decision to join.
